What is the Mission Inn Hotel & Spa?

The Mission Inn Hotel & Spa is a historic luxury hotel located in Riverside, California. Known for its stunning Spanish Mission-style architecture, the hotel features uniquely decorated rooms, award-winning restaurants, a full-service spa, and beautiful event spaces. It has served as a landmark since 1876 and is renowned for its rich history, hosting dignitaries, celebrities, and U.S. presidents. The Mission Inn is also a popular destination for weddings, special occasions, and holiday celebrations.

What you will have an opportunity to do:

The Director of Finance serves as a strategic business partner to the General Manager and executive leadership team, overseeing all financial operations of the historic Mission Inn Hotel & Spa. This role is responsible for ensuring the financial integrity of the property, driving profitability, and providing insightful analysis to support operational and strategic decision-making.

This leader will balance hands-on financial oversight with high-level strategy, ensuring compliance, accuracy, and performance in a luxury, full-service hospitality environ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Act as a key advisor to the General Manager on all financial and business matters
  • Develop and execute financial strategies aligned with ownership goals and property objectives
  • Lead long-term financial planning, forecasting, and budgeting processes
  • Provide actionable insights to improve profitability, cost control, and revenue optimization
  • Oversee all accounting functions including general ledger, accounts payable/receivable, payroll, and cash management
  • Ensure timely and accurate mon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reporting
  • Maintain strong internal controls and compliance with company policies and GAAP standards
  • Manage audits, tax filings, and regulatory reporting requirements
  • Analyze financial performance and identify trends, risks, and opportunities
  • Deliver clear and concise financial reports to ownership and corporate leadership
  • Partner with department heads to review expenses, labor productivity, and operational efficiency
  •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) and benchmark against industry standards
  • Lead, mentor, and develop the finance and accounting team
  • Foster a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ement
  • Ensure proper training and development plans are in place for team members
  • Safeguard company assets through effective controls and procedures
  • Oversee insurance programs, contracts, and financial risk mitigation strategies
  • Ensure compliance with local, state, and federal regulations
#ZR250

What are we looking for?

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or related field (CPA preferred)
  • 8–10+ years of progressive finance leadership experience in hospitality, preferably within luxury or upper-upscale hotels
  • Prior experience as a Director of Finance or Assistant Director of Finance in a full-service property
  • Strong knowledge of hotel financial systems, budgeting, forecasting, and reporting
  • Proven ability to influence and partner with operational leaders
  • Exceptional analytical, organizational, and communication skills

Pyramid Hotel Group is a leading privately held hotel management company in North America's hospitality industry, with its headquarters in Boston, MA, US. Established in 1999, the company manages, maintains, and improves hotels and resorts in some of the most desirable locations across the United States, Ireland, and the Caribbean. Known for their commitment to operational excellence, Pyramid Hotel Group specializes in a large portfolio of industry services that include property management, project management, asset management, and receivership services.
